## Deployment

Before supporting customers on Cartloom's checkout flow, please understand our load-testing deployment. We run synthetic checkout sessions against the staging cluster every night, ramping to peak traffic over twenty minutes. If a customer reports slowness, first check whether a load run overlapped their session. The load generator deploys with a fixed profile, and its active configuration values are shown below.

settings of fafog-haduf:
ZORIX_PIN=4648
ZORIX_METRICS_HOST=metrics.zorix.paliqsys.corp
ZORIX_LOG_LEVEL=info
ZORIX_TENANT=druix

## Session Handling — Stringharvest Extraction Script

Stringharvest, our translation-string extraction script, runs under a service session rather than a user session. Each run requests a session scoped to the locale catalog, valid for 30 minutes; long extractions renew automatically. Support team: if a customer reports missing translations, check the last run's session log for early expiry before escalating. To query the run-log endpoint, authenticate with the read-only bearer token below:

portal login ticket: eyJhbGciOiJIUzI1NiIsInR5cCI6IkpXVCJ9.eyJzdWIiOiIMjvRAf3PEFIn0.nuv9gjixLtnr

**Ticket PARITY-412: Kestrel SDK catch-up**

Quick one for the weekly sync: the Kestrel-Go SDK is still missing batched uploads and retry hints that Kestrel-JS shipped two releases ago. Partner teams keep asking. Plan is to land both behind a flag this sprint and cut a minor release. Needs a sign-off from the owner named below.

account owner for bajef-badup: Drueth Kelath Pelael Holwyn